About Wetherby High School

Wetherby High School is a mixed, non-denominational foundation school and for students aged 11-16. The school is located in the heart of Wetherby, in a semi-rural area of north Leeds. The school is a growing school, with almost 640 students on roll.
The former secondary modern school was built on its current site in 1966, and became a foundation school in 2010. The school falls under the remit of Leeds City Council.
